OSHA Inspection: CABRAS MARINE CORPORATION

Referral inspection · Safety discipline

On , OSHA opened a referral safety inspection of CABRAS MARINE CORPORATION in NAVAL BASE GUAM SHIPYARD, SANTA RITA, GU 96915 (NAICS 336611). OSHA activity number 341410728.

What this inspection record means

OSHA opens inspections for many reasons: rout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

29 CFR 1910.212(a)(1): One or more methods of machine guarding was not provided to protect the operator and other employees in the machine area from hazards such as those created by point of operation, ingoing nip points, rotating parts, flying chips and sparks:   (a) On April 21, 2016, in the machine shop, the Le Blond lathe chuck was not guarded to protect the operator from rotating parts.

29 CFR 1910.213(c)(1): Circular handfed ripsaw(s) were not guarded by an automatically adjusting hood which completely enclosed that portion of the saw above the table and above the material being cut:   (a) On April 21, 2016, in the carpenter's shop, the Dayton table saw, was not guarded by an automatically adjusting hood which completely enclosed that portion of the saw above the table and above the material being cut.

29 CFR 1910.213(h)(1): The sides of the lower exposed portion of the blade of radial saw(s) were not guarded to the full diameter of the blade by a device that automatically adjusted itself to the thickness of the stock and remained in contact with the stock being cut to give maximum protection possible for the operation being performed:   (a) On April 21, 2016, in the carpenter's shop, the lower exposed portion of the DeWALT 16-inch radial arm saw, serial # 563579, was not guarded with a device that automatically adjusted itself to the thickness of the stock and remained in contact with the material being cut.

29 CFR 1910.213(h)(4): Radial saw(s) were not installed in a manner so as to cause the cutting head to return gently to the starting position when released by the operator:   (a) On April 21, 2016, in the carpenter's shop, the DeWALT 16-inch radial arm saw, Serial # 563579, cutting head would not return to the starting position when released by the operator.
